In the latest explAInED episode, we’re joined by Vera Cubero, a visionary leader in AI and education at the North Carolina Department of Public Instruction, who discussed her role in leading the state’s AI framework after the 2022 launch of ChatGPT revealed the immediate need for educational change.We discussed the necessity of instructional redesign, shifting the focus from basic AI literacy to prioritizing durable human skills like critical thinking and judgment. Vera introduced the concept of the knowledge architect, where educators use AI to customize resources for their specific students, and explained how Micro PBL 2.0 leverages AI to make project-based learning more manageable and standards-aligned.We also explored the North Carolina AI Solv-a-thon, a pitch contest that empowers students to use AI to solve real-world community challenges. After a slow start last year, this year’s Solv-a-thon had 25 competing teams from middle and high schools throughout North Carolina, with students developing solutions for issues like homelessness, DMV backlogs, and protecting local wildlife.Addressing the difficult mindset shift regarding the cheating narrative surrounding AI use, Vera argued that we must move past a "blocking and banning" mentality to ensure students are prepared for a future workforce where AI is ubiquitous. Finally, she shared her goals for scaling these pilots statewide and using portfolios to promote metacognition and reflection on AI use to capture the actual process of learning.
